all I want for Tmas
The original 3 3/4" A-Team action figures were kinda ugly, with the Mr. T in green being the least hideous of the lot. But they were the same scale as both the GI Joe and Star Wars lines, which is clearly an invitation for the greatest crossover in toy history.
